Every twenty years there's a detailed survey of the birds of the UK and Ireland and today, the 2007-2011 Bird Atlas is published. Adam Rutherford hears from Dawn Balmer from the British Trust for Ornithology about the citizen scientists, the forty thousand volunteers who collected data on a staggering 19 million birds - 502 different species - and meets their record breaking volunteer, Chris Reynolds. A 73 year old retired maths teacher, Chris took part in the previous three atlases and walked thousands of miles in all seasons across his patch in the Outer Hebrides. After the Research and Development was done, the F1 governing body changed the rules, and there was no longer space for a flywheel on their car. No matter, these things have other uses. Mark Smout from Smout Allen has proposed a design for the Isle of Sheppey in Kent, which uses banks of these flywheels to regulate the energy from the nearby wind farm. It also uses spare electricity to grow a sea defence for the island. The International Commission on Missing Persons in Sarajevo used DNA matching to identify the thousands killed in the former Yugoslavia and has since helped in conflict zones around the world. Now, working with Interpol, scientists from the ICMP are called on to assist in victim identification after natural disasters as well, and head of forensic services, Dr Thomas Parsons, tells Adam Rutherford that a team will be sent to the Philippines on Monday.The enormous ash cloud following the 2010 eruption of the Icelandic volcano, Eyjafjallajokell, grounded aircraft across Europe for more than a week and caused unprecedented disruption. Dr Fred Prata has invented a weather radar for ash, and off the Bay of Biscay, his AVOID infra red camera system, the Airborne Volcanic Object Imaging Detector, has just been tested after a ton of Icelandic volcanic ash was dropped by aeroplane into the sky. Out of the 93 they trapped and blood tested, 5 had antibodies for the normally-deadly squirrel pox, suggesting they had contracted the pox and survived. It's early days but this could mean that reds are developing a level of resistance to the squirrel pox, like rabbits have to myxomatosis. The Personal Genome Project-UK was launched today and participants are being warned, as part of the screening process, that their anonymity won't be guaranteed. Stephan Beck, Professor of Medical Genomics at University College London's Cancer Institute and the Director of PGP-UK, tells Dr Lucie Green that anonymised genetic databases aren't impregnable, and that it is already possible for an individual's identity to be established using jigsaw identification. This new "open access" approach, he says, will rely on altruistic early-adopters who are comfortable with having their genetic data, their medical history and their personal details freely available as a tool for research. Exposing zinc oxide PV cells to noise alongside light generated up to 50% more current than just light alone. Mobile phones and cameras captured the meteor, moving at 19 kilometres a second (that's 60 times the speed of sound) and the enormous damage caused by the airblast. But a study published in Nature this week by a team in Spain, focuses on the impact underground, on the make up of the soil in a sizeable part of the earth's land, the drylands. The impact of increasing aridity is dramatic, affecting the delicate balance between nitrogen, carbon and phosphorus, with serious implications for soil fertility.
